How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Paddock Hills?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Paddock Hills Studio Apartments | $1,297 | $845 | $1,610 |
| Paddock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,464 | $699 | $2,425 |
| Paddock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,727 | $950 | $3,970 |
| Paddock Hills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,911 | $886 | $4,380 |
| Paddock Hills 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,935 | $805 | $3,506 |
